Output 159dffa1037f6cccc29a3d7557f8008f6bf8fda4eed094a887bece74c86ed67d:1

value
1948406
script pubkey
OP_0 OP_PUSHBYTES_20 58a628504d7a5e85e0cd0b1cfebd4b1f134cf956
address
bc1qtznzs5zd0f0gtcxdpvw0a02truf5e72klfl5xe
transaction
159dffa1037f6cccc29a3d7557f8008f6bf8fda4eed094a887bece74c86ed67d
confirmations
155130
spent
true